You are an expert in pedagogy and active recall techniques. Create a deck of 20 flashcards on the following topic: [TOPIC]. For each flashcard, provide:
- Front (Question): A clear, precise question targeting a key concept
- Back (Answer): A concise answer (2-3 sentences max) with the essential takeaway
- Hint: A keyword or mnemonic to aid memorization
- Level: Easy, Medium, or Hard
Rules to follow:
- Each card must cover only one concept (minimum information principle)
- Vary the question types: definition, application, comparison, cause-effect
- Order the cards from most fundamental to most advanced
- Use simple, direct language
- Add concrete examples where relevant
Format the output as a table with columns: Number | Question | Answer | Hint | Level

Why this prompt works
This prompt applies Piotr Wozniak's (creator of SuperMemo) minimum information principle, ensuring one card per concept for optimal retention. The table structure with difficulty levels allows direct integration into spaced repetition software. The variety of question types engages different cognitive processes, reinforcing long-term memorization.

Frequently Asked Questions
How do I import the flashcards generated by Mistral into Anki?
Copy the generated table into a text file (.txt) separating questions and answers with tabs. In Anki, go to File > Import, select your file, and choose 'Tab' as the separator. Map the first column to the front and the second to the back. For the advanced prompt, tags in square brackets will be automatically recognized by Anki as labels.
How many flashcards can Mistral generate in a single request?
Mistral can generate between 20 and 50 high-quality flashcards in a single request. Beyond 50 cards, quality may decline and some cards may become repetitive. For larger decks, it's better to break the topic down into sub-topics, make several successive requests, and then merge the results in your review tool.
Can Mistral create flashcards with images or mathematical formulas?
Mistral can describe images to include and generate formulas using LaTeX notation (compatible with Anki and Quizlet). For formulas, specify 'use LaTeX notation for formulas' in your prompt. For images, Mistral can suggest visual descriptions or diagrams to reproduce, but does not directly generate images. You can manually supplement with screenshots or diagrams.
